This is without the LO Appearance theme framework active.

Tools -> Options -> Appearance 'Enable application theming' unchecked, and any
of the 'Automatic', 'Light' or 'Dark' appearance modes only.

If you leave the value set to 'Automatic' it should follow os/DE appearance
theme changes between light or dark color sense.  While using 'Light' or 'Dark'
forces bypass of the os/DE provided color sense and then toggling one or the
other will leave some elements of the UI incorrectly themed. Things are not
100% correct with the 'Automatic' sense, but it tracks os/DE color sense
changes better than the Light/Dark. And for the most part simply restarting
LibreOffice after changing the os/DE color sense or making a selection other
than 'Automatic' will set things correctly.

>From 25.2 onward, best recommendation is to go ahead and select 'Enable
application theming' and also to install one or more of the Appearance theme
extensions linked from the Appearance panel. 

Activating or changing between the appearance themes still requires LO restart,
but the results in UI are more predictable.
